PUTRAJAYA: Samirah Muzaffar, who is accused of murdering her husband, Cradle Fund chief executive officer Nazrin Hassan, has been denied bail again pending trial.
Her application to be released on bail pending trial on Sept 3 was unanimously dismissed by the Court of Appeal’s three-member bench comprising Justices Datuk Kamardin Hashim, Datuk Rhodzariah Bujang and Datuk Mohamad Zabidin Mohd Diah.
